Beach Boys Brian Wilson To Retire From The Road
. London's Evening Standard newspaper reports that Wilson claims touring is now hard work. "As I get older it gets harder for me," he said. "But when I'm sitting down at the keyboard and my band's behind me, I can do it. This could be the last time I play here. I'm going to miss it but I'm getting a little bit old for touring." Wilson will be in London in for three nights in September at the Royal Festival Hall. "London is my favorite city in the whole world," he said. "I love the people here.
